Transaction 39ef59b52280709fe8e3768bd1a586eb836fcb30893475134fc3f29164b817d0
1 Input
1 Output
-
39ef59b52280709fe8e3768bd1a586eb836fcb30893475134fc3f29164b817d0:0
- value
- 1486837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 654fce7ae0b7119dc6c0bdaa62767936452f7c4f OP_EQUAL
- address
- 3AvhmyYqWGHeJYnFBfrYAzTrpwx5bBofWZ